Abrasion resistance Tester for printed ink layers

The print ink layer abrasion resistance tester applies pressure to the printed ink layer through a friction head and performs reciprocating friction, simulating actual wear conditions during use. It detects the degree of ink layer detachment to evaluate the durability of printed products, making it suitable for quality control of packaging, labels, and other products.

Selection of Wear Testing Machine: Types of Abrasion Wheels and Load Setting Methods
The test results of the wear testing machine primarily depend on the type of grinding wheel and the load setting. Grinding wheels include rubber wheels, abrasive wheels, wire wheels, and fiber wheels, among others. The selection should be matched based on the material characteristics and the actual wear scenario.
Application of Sand Abrasion Tester in the Coatings Industry
The sand falling abrasion tester evaluates the wear resistance of coatings by allowing standard abrasives to fall from a fixed height to impact the coating surface and measuring the amount of abrasive required to wear away a certain thickness.
